Medicare Rebates

I am now classified under a relatively new Medicare category of MENTAL HEALTH SOCIAL WORKER. As such you can get a refund from Medicare of approximately $66 from my standard fee of $120.00.

The idea of this service is to make mental health services more accessible to the community. If you are in distress, your doctor can refer you to Mental Health Social Worker for the treatment of anxiety, or depression etc. as part of a co-ordinated health care plan. This can also include couple or family counselling if this is seen as the prime cause, or a major contributing factor to the distress.

To get this benefit you have to be referred by a GP as part of a Mental Health Care Plan. GP’s are entitled to a rebate for completing this plan (Item2710) as it can be time consuming. Once Medicare is billed for the item the referral is activated. A letter of referral from the doctor is also required as it is in the case of any other referral

This service is limited to a maximum of 12 planned sessions in a calendar year. I am required to report the client’s progress back to the GP every six sessions. In special circumstances another six sessions can be allocated in a calendar year.

Discussions with Medicare reveal that the referral must include the name, address and provider number of the service to which the patient is being referred. The provider number and the address are critical - as they are linked to the provider number by Medicare. If these details are absent or incorrect, the claim will not be accepted.

The referral also needs to include the Patient’s Medicare number. This enables me to confirm that Medicare has accepted your use of item number 2710 – as the use of item number 80160 is dependent upon this.

As with other referrals, the full details of the referring Doctor need to be included. This includes: the full name of the referring Doctor, their practice address, their provider number and the referral date.
